Control.BringToFront メソッド

定義

コントロールを z オーダーの最前面へ移動します。

C#
public void BringToFront();

次のコード例では、 メソッドを Label 呼び出すことによって が確実に BringToFront 表示されるようにします。 この例では、 という名前の と、 という名前label1panel1Panel を持Formつ がLabel必要です。

C#
private void MakeLabelVisible()
{
   /* If the panel contains label1, bring it 
   * to the front to make sure it is visible. */
   if(panel1.Contains(label1))
   {
      label1.BringToFront();
   }
}

注釈

コントロールは z オーダーの前面に移動します。 コントロールが別のコントロールの子である場合、子コントロールは z オーダーの前面に移動されます。 BringToFront はコントロールを最上位のコントロールにせず、イベントを Paint 発生させません。

適用対象

製品 バージョン
.NET Framework 1.1, 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1
Windows Desktop 3.0, 3.1, 5, 6, 7, 8, 9, 10

こちらもご覧ください